Author Denenberg, Barry.

Title Elisabeth : the princess bride / by Barry Denenberg.

Publication Info. New York : Scholastic, 2003.

Summary The diary of Princess Elisabeth, written in 1853-1854, describing her engagement and marriage to her cousin Franz Joseph I, Emperor of Austria. Includes historical notes concerning her life as Empress.
